Balance Transfer Card Comparison
| Card | Intro APR | Transfer Fee | Standout Feature |
|---|---|---|---|
| Citi Simplicity | 0% for 21 months | 3-5% | No late fees or penalty APR |
| Wells Fargo Reflect | 0% for up to 21 months | 3-5% | Cell phone protection included |
| Chase Slate Edge | 0% for 18 months | 3-5% | Annual APR reduction for on-time payments |
Which Should You Choose?
Choose Citi Simplicity if: you want the longest intro period with the fewest penalty risks. Choose Wells Fargo Reflect if: you also want cell phone protection as a bonus perk.
